Esempio semplificato e semplificato: FLAGS='--archive --exclude="foo bar.txt"' rsync $FLAGS dir1 dir2 Ho bisogno di includere le virgolette come se il comando fosse così: rsync --archive --exclude="foo bar.txt" dir1 dir2
Ho usato la shell Bash su Linux per anni e sono molto veloce con esso. Facendo spesso appello al completamento automatico premendo il tasto Tab, sono in grado di scrivere comandi lunghi in pochi tasti. Di recente al mio lavoro ho iniziato a utilizzare il prompt dei comandi di Windows …
Vorrei migliorare un po 'il mio flusso di lavoro con Bash, e mi rendo conto che spesso voglio eseguire lo stesso comando su un altro eseguibile. Qualche esempio: Git (dove vorrei cambiare rapidamente la seconda parola): git diff foo/bar.c git checkout foo/bar.c Cat / rm (dove deve essere cambiata solo …
C'è un modo per lsvisualizzare solo le directory anziché i file e le directory? Dalla pagina man: -d, --directory list directory entries instead of contents, and do not derefer‐ ence symbolic links Quindi se lo scrivo nella /directory mi aspetto di vedere solo le directory. Invece mostra "." $ cd …
Sono un nuovo utente di GNU Screen. Uso Bash da molto tempo e voglio provare GNU Screen. Come sapete, GNU Screen usa 'Ca' (Control-A) come carattere di comando. Il problema è che questo interferisce con la funzione di modifica della linea in Bash (e GNU Readline), perché Control-A in Bash …
Possibile duplicato: completamento della scheda con directory / collegamenti quando ho un foocollegamento simbolico a una directory bar/e comincio a digitare fe premo tab, si completa fooma mi piacerebbe completarlo in foo/modo da poter aggiungere immediatamente il carattere successivo per ulteriori completamenti. Come lo posso fare?
File Supponiamo che /foo/srccontenga solo A.ce che /foo/destcontenga sia A.ce B.c. E supponiamo che io esegua il seguente comando: rsync /foo/src/ /foo/dest Sarà rsynccancellare B.c? Cartelle Supponiamo ora che /foo/srccontenga la directory Acon alcuni file al suo interno e che /foo/destcontenga entrambe le directory Ae B, ognuna con alcuni file …
Trovo che \nnon funzioni in sed con Mac OS X. In particolare, supponiamo che io voglia dividere le parole separate da un singolo spazio in linee: # input foo bar Io uso, echo "foo bar" | sed 's/ /\n/' Ma il risultato è stupido, \nnon è sfuggito! foonbar Dopo aver …
Penso di avere due directory con lo stesso contenuto, ma voglio verificarlo. Inoltre, voglio escludere una cartella che si trova in entrambe le directory. Come posso farlo?
Se avessi avviato un processo con una e commerciale ( &) alla fine, verrà biforcato in background. Al termine, ottengo un output simile a [1]+ Fertig my_script Ho una distribuzione localizzata, ma questo non dovrebbe importare. Quello che vedo è l'ID lavoro tra parentesi quadre seguito da un segno più …
Vorrei creare collegamenti simbolici ( ln -s) a tutti i file (o a una classe di file, ad esempio, terminando con .bar) in una determinata directory. Dimmi che sono nel CWD e che tipo ls ../source/*.barmi dà foo.bar baz.bar come posso passare l'elenco dei parametri a ln -squello che alla …
Ho creato una nuova attività {} Bash passato la mia directory home / dir "C: \ Users \ TMB \" e aggiunto bash come applicazione C: \ cygwin \ bin \ bash.exe Quando apro Bash, non è possibile utilizzare le utility UNIX / Cygwin di base. Come configuro ConEmu per …
Ho appena installato Homebrew su bash sul mio Mac e ora devo fare questo: Dopo aver installato Homebrew, inserisci la directory Homebrew nella parte superiore della variabile di ambiente PATH. Puoi farlo aggiungendo la seguente riga nella parte inferiore del tuo ~/.bashrcfile. export PATH=/usr/local/bin:$PATH "ls -a" mostra .bash_profilee .bashrc.save. Aggiungo …
A volte, quando voglio passare alla directory principale, scrivo erroneamente cd ,,invece di cd ... C'è un modo in cui posso fare in modo che Bash consideri queste affermazioni come uguali? Non uso mai le virgole nei miei comandi. Idealmente, vorrei alias ,,a ... Quando ho provato questo, non ha …
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.